According to the American Optometric Association's (AOA) 2011 American Eye-Q survey, parents have some concern about the effects of the evolving technology. Fifty-three percent of respondents with children 18 or younger believe 3D viewing is harmful to a child's vision or eyes and 29 percent of parents feel very concerned that their child may damage their eyes due to prolonged use of computers or hand-held electronic devices. Today's classroom is extremely visual, making it critical for students to keep excellent eye health.
